🥘 Ingredients

10 items
  • 2 cups All-purpose flour
  • 1 tablespoon Baking powder
  • 0.5 teaspoons Salt
  • 1 teaspoon Freshly ground black pepper
  • 1 tablespoon Granulated sugar
  • 1.5 cups Sharp cheddar cheese, shredded
  • 1 cup Whole milk
  • 0.25 cups Unsalted butter, melted and slightly cooled
  • 1 unit Large egg
  • 0.25 cups Green onions, finely chopped (optional)

📝 Instructions

10 steps
1

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Line a 12-cup muffin tin with paper liners or grease it lightly with nonstick spray.

2

In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, salt, black pepper, and sugar until well combined.

3

Add the shredded cheddar cheese to the dry mixture and gently toss to coat the cheese in flour. This helps ensure the cheese is evenly distributed throughout the batter.

4

In a separate bowl, whisk together the milk, melted butter, and egg until smooth and fully combined.

5

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ients. Stir gently with a spatula or wooden spoon until just combined. Avoid overmixing; it’s okay if there are a few small lumps in the batter.

6

If using chopped green onions, fold them into the batter at this point.

7

Divide the batter evenly among the prepared muffin cups, filling each about 3/4 full.

8

Bake in the preheated oven for 18-20 minutes, or until the tops of the muffins are golden and a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.

9

Remove the muffins from the oven and let them cool in the pan for 5 minutes. Then transfer them to a wire rack to cool slightly before serving.

10

Serve warm or at room temperature. These muffins are best enjoyed fresh but can be stored in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 2 days.

Nutrition Facts

1 serving (68.1g)
Calories
191
% Daily Value*
Total Fat 9.8 g 13%
Saturated Fat 6.1 g 31%
Polyunsaturated Fat 0.0 g
Cholesterol 43 mg 14%
Sodium 321 mg 14%
Total Carbohydrate 18.9 g 7%
Dietary Fiber 0.7 g 2%
Total Sugars 2.2 g
Protein 6.9 g 14%
Vitamin D 0.4 mcg 2%
Calcium 131 mg 10%
Iron 1.0 mg 6%
Potassium 74 mg 2%
